"""RAG Engine - Core retrieval-augmented generation service."""
from typing import Optional
import hashlib
from src.clients.embeddings import get_embedding
from src.clients.chat_provider import chat_completion
from src.clients.qdrant_client import search_similar, ensure_collection_exists, get_collection_info
from src.config.settings import settings
from .conversation_context import ConversationContext
from .citation_system import CitationSystem
from .response_formatter import ResponseFormatter
class RAGEngine:
"""Core RAG engine for question answering with document retrieval."""
def __init__(self, collection_name: Optional[str] = None):
"""Initialize RAG engine.
Args:
collection_name: Qdrant collection name for document storage.
"""
self.collection_name = collection_name or settings.QDRANT_COLLECTION
self.context_manager = ConversationContext()
self.citation_system = CitationSystem()
self.response_formatter = ResponseFormatter()
self._initialized = False
self._embedding_cache = {} # Cache embeddings to avoid repeated API calls
self._collection_has_data = False
async def initialize(self) -> bool:
"""Initialize the RAG engine and ensure collection exists.
Returns:
True if initialization successful.
"""
if self._initialized:
return True
self._initialized = ensure_collection_exists(
self.collection_name,
vector_size=settings.EMBEDDING_DIM, # OpenRouter embedding dimensions (default 3072)
)
# Check if collection already has data
if self._initialized:
collection_info = get_collection_info(self.collection_name)
if collection_info and collection_info.get('points_count', 0) > 0:
self._collection_has_data = True
print(f"✓ Collection '{self.collection_name}' has {collection_info['points_count']} documents - using existing data")
else:
print(f"⚠ Collection '{self.collection_name}' is empty - embeddings will be generated for new documents")
return self._initialized
def _get_cached_embedding(self, text: str) -> Optional[list]:
"""Get cached embedding for text if available.
Args:
text: Text to get embedding for.
Returns:
Cached embedding or None.
"""
cache_key = hashlib.md5(text.encode()).hexdigest()
return self._embedding_cache.get(cache_key)
def _cache_embedding(self, text: str, embedding: list) -> None:
"""Cache embedding for text.
Args:
text: Text that was embedded.
embedding: Embedding vector to cache.
"""
cache_key = hashlib.md5(text.encode()).hexdigest()
self._embedding_cache[cache_key] = embedding
# Keep cache size limited
if len(self._embedding_cache) > 100:
# Remove oldest entry (first inserted)
oldest_key = next(iter(self._embedding_cache))
del self._embedding_cache[oldest_key]
async def query(
self,
question: str,
conversation_history: Optional[list] = None,
selected_text: Optional[str] = None,
top_k: int = 5,
include_citations: bool = True,
language: Optional[str] = "en",
) -> dict:
"""Process a question using RAG.
Args:
question: User question to answer.
conversation_history: Previous conversation messages.
selected_text: Optional selected text for context filtering.
top_k: Number of documents to retrieve.
include_citations: Whether to include source citations.
language: Language code for the response (en, ur, ur-PK, ar, es, ...).
Returns:
Dictionary with answer, sources, and metadata.
"""
# Build context-aware query
enhanced_query = self.context_manager.build_query(
question=question,
conversation_history=conversation_history,
selected_text=selected_text,
)
# Check cache first to avoid unnecessary API calls
query_embedding = self._get_cached_embedding(enhanced_query)
if query_embedding is None:
# Only call embedding API if not in cache and needed
if self._collection_has_data:
# Collection has data, generate embedding for search
query_embedding = get_embedding(enhanced_query)
self._cache_embedding(enhanced_query, query_embedding)
print("✓ Generated embedding for query (cached for future use)")
else:
# Collection is empty, use fallback
print("⚠ Collection empty - using fallback embedding")
from src.clients.embeddings import simple_embedding
query_embedding = simple_embedding(enhanced_query)
else:
print("✓ Using cached embedding for query")
# Search for relevant documents
search_results = search_similar(
collection_name=self.collection_name,
query_vector=query_embedding,
top_k=top_k,
score_threshold=settings.RAG_SIMILARITY_THRESHOLD,
)
print(f"✓ Search returned {len(search_results)} results")
for i, r in enumerate(search_results[:3]):
score = r.get('score', 0)
url = r.get('payload', {}).get('url', 'N/A')
print(f" Result {i+1}: score={score:.4f}, url={url}")
if not search_results:
print("⚠ No results above threshold, trying without threshold...")
search_results = search_similar(
collection_name=self.collection_name,
query_vector=query_embedding,
top_k=top_k,
score_threshold=0.0,
)
print(f"✓ Search (no threshold) returned {len(search_results)} results")
# Build context from retrieved documents
context_text = self._build_context(search_results)
# Generate answer with context
system_prompt = self._get_system_prompt(context_text, include_citations, language)
messages = []
if conversation_history:
messages.extend(conversation_history[-6:]) # Last 6 messages for context
messages.append({"role": "user", "content": question})
answer = chat_completion(
messages=messages,
system_prompt=system_prompt,
max_tokens=settings.RAG_MAX_RESPONSE_TOKENS,
temperature=0.7,
)
# Format response with citations
citations = []
if include_citations:
citations = self.citation_system.extract_citations(search_results)
return self.response_formatter.format_response(
answer=answer,
sources=search_results,
citations=citations,
query=question,
)
def _build_context(self, search_results: list) -> str:
"""Build context string from search results.
Args:
search_results: List of search results from Qdrant.
Returns:
Formatted context string.
"""
if not search_results:
return "No relevant documentation found."
context_parts = []
for i, result in enumerate(search_results, 1):
payload = result.get("payload", {})
# Support both 'text' (from main.py ingestion) and 'content' (from src/ indexing)
content = payload.get("text", payload.get("content", ""))
title = payload.get("title", "Document")
source = payload.get("url", payload.get("source_url", payload.get("file_path", "")))
context_parts.append(
f"[Source {i}] {title}\n"
f"Content: {content}\n"
f"Reference: {source}\n"
)
return "\n---\n".join(context_parts)
# Language names for response translation instructions
LANGUAGE_NAMES = {
"en": "English",
"ur": "Urdu (اردو script)",
"ur-PK": "Roman Urdu (Urdu written in Latin script)",
"ar": "Arabic (العربية)",
"es": "Spanish",
"fr": "French",
"de": "German",
"zh": "Chinese (Simplified)",
"hi": "Hindi",
"pt": "Portuguese",
"ru": "Russian",
"ja": "Japanese",
}
def _get_system_prompt(self, context: str, include_citations: bool, language: Optional[str] = "en") -> str:
"""Generate system prompt for RAG responses.
Args:
context: Retrieved document context.
include_citations: Whether to include citation instructions.
language: Response language code.
Returns:
System prompt string.
"""
citation_instruction = ""
if include_citations:
citation_instruction = (
"When answering, cite your sources using [Source N] notation "
"where N corresponds to the source number in the context. "
)
language_instruction = ""
lang = (language or "en").strip()
if lang != "en":
lang_name = self.LANGUAGE_NAMES.get(lang, lang)
language_instruction = (
f"IMPORTANT: Respond ENTIRELY in {lang_name}. "
"Translate your answer naturally; keep technical terms and code in English where standard. "
)
return f"""You are a helpful AI assistant for Physical AI & Humanoid Robotics in Education.
{language_instruction}{citation_instruction}
RULES:
1. Answer concisely in 2-4 sentences using the context below
2. Cite sources using [Source N] when referencing specific information
3. Only say "I cannot find information" if context is completely empty
4. Be direct - no unnecessary introductions, tables, or lengthy explanations
5. Use simple, clear language
CONTEXT:
{context}
Keep answers short and to the point. Use ONLY information from the context above."""
